Output 74e68f32e9981520645aedcdfec6dcc045fef191a5f2a5f28f7563ad85929b4b:2

value
5205616925
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f013c07410800d7d23d77a03b30d488218279419c5807407f849b31edf904362
address
tb1p7qfuqaqssqxh6g7h0gpmxr2gsgvz09qeckq8gplcfxe3ahusgd3qxheplv
transaction
74e68f32e9981520645aedcdfec6dcc045fef191a5f2a5f28f7563ad85929b4b
confirmations
71017
spent
true